## Local Setup: Health Checks

New to Marrowbeck? The API sits behind the Larkspur load balancer, which polls `/healthz` every ten seconds. Locally, the health endpoint reports unhealthy until the service can reach its database, so the balancer simulator will mark your node down at first. To get a passing check, start the database and configure the service with the connection string below.

primary connection of yagep-kahip = redis://giliel_svc:zYiKsLL2PLpfPL@db-348f.xolmarsys.corp:5432/fenwyn

Capacity note for the Bramblewick export retry queue. Failed exports are requeued with exponential backoff, and the queue depth is our main capacity signal: sustained depth above the high-water mark means downstream Pellis storage is saturated, not that we need more workers. As the new contractor, please don't raise worker counts without checking storage latency first — it usually makes things worse. Retry timing, backoff caps, and the high-water threshold are all driven by the constants shown below.

limits module of yagef-bajog:
TIERS = {
    "druael": 370,
    "tamix": 286,
    "pelius": 541,
    "pelael": 78,
    "pelox": 47,
    "ralath": 533,
    "drumir": 801,
}

Subject: Deep-link routing handover — Wayfinder 3.2

Hi Priya,

Handing over the Wayfinder deep-link router release. All route-map changes are staged in the linkmap-32 branch; each map must pass the collision checker before bundling. Note that the iOS resolver caches aggressively, so bump the map version on every change. Signed bundles only — unsigned maps are silently ignored by clients. The active deploy key is:

deploy key for yajop-fahop: bky3_h1v

Handover: Ledgerloom export memory

Hi team — passing the spreadsheet-export baton to you. Short version: big exports from Ledgerloom were eating memory because we buffered whole workbooks before streaming. I switched the exporter to chunked writes last sprint, and OOM tickets dropped to near zero. If support sees memory complaints again, first check whether the customer's instance picked up the new exporter settings — a few self-hosted folks are still on old values. The current recommended configuration is listed here.

deployment values, kajep-kageg:
[praix]
host = praix.paliqcorp.corp
user = praix_svc
database = praix_prod